摘要
建立了高效液相色谱法(high performance liquid chromatography,HPLC)测定纳米海绵中游离甲醛含量的分析方法。以2, 4-二硝基苯肼为衍生剂与甲醛反应生成2, 4-二硝基苯腙。在352nm波长处,HPLC测定,外标法定量。该方法在0.02~20mg/L浓度范围内具有良好线性,相关系数(r^2)为0.9999,相对标准偏差小于5%。该方法操作简单、灵敏度高、重复性好,可用于纳米海绵中游离甲醛含量的测定。
To establish a method for determination of free formaldehyde content in nano-sponge by high performance liquid chromatography(HPLC).The 2,4-dinitrophenylhydrazine was used as a derivatizing agent to react with formaldehyde to form 2,4-dinitrophenylhydrazine.At the wavelength of 352 nm,the sample was determined by HPLC and quantified by external standard method.This method had good linearity in the concentration range of 0.02-20 mg/L,the correlation coefficient(r^2)was 0.9999,and the relative standard deviation(RSD)was less than 5%.This method is simple in operation,high in sensitivity and good in repeatability,which can be used for the determination of free formaldehyde content in nano-sponges.
